Abstract: This paper deals
with a cultural fraction of the Javanese Muslim called Islam Mataraman.
Historically Islam Mataraman originated from the Islam that flourished during
the era of the Mataram Kingdom in an inland Javanese island. This paper tries
to explore the unique characters of this group of the Javanese Muslims that
distinguish them from others culturally and politically. It maintains that
Islam Mataraman is not only about culture, politics or belief, but also about
the integration between them all. Integration is the key word in this paper.
The paper also tries to show that in integration process, religion is not
always the key player. In fact we are not interested in discussing the winner
and the looser in this process. We are rather interested in showing that the
integration is unique and complicated process, and that Islam in this part of
Java is a perfect model of how religion, culture and politics can converge
without there being a sense of domination or marginalization. To carry out its
task, the paper will consult not only the local authoritative scholars in this
field, but also the international experts so as to have a balanced view of the
problem. At the end, we will also try to discuss how this integration imply on
the political attitudes of the Muslim Mataraman.
